About California Child Care Resource
Based on IRS filings
California Child Care Resource is a nonprofit organization focused on Human Services, based in SAN FRANCISCO, CA. IRS filing data is available from 2020 through 2024. As of 2024, the organization holds $9.2M in total assets. In 2024, it awarded 2 grants totaling $18K. Net investment income was $98K.

Financial History
Multi-year comparison from IRS filings
| Metric | 2024 | 2022 | 2021 |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Assets | $9,242,924 | $8,559,164 | $6,930,028 |
| Revenue | $8,000,209 | $9,505,211 | $5,588,275 |
| Expenses | $6,773,745 | $8,882,940 | $4,514,690 |
| Qualifying Distributions | — | — | — |
| Net Investment Income | $98,050 | $10,626 | $388 |
| Distributable Amount | — | — | — |

Giving History
Grant recipients and amounts by year
Among its reported 2024 grants, the largest include CAP of San Luis Obispo ($10,000), Merced County Office of Educa ($8,000).
| Recipient | Purpose | Amount |
|---|---|---|
| CAP of San Luis Obispo San Luis Obispo, CA | FFN Pilot Project | $10,000 |
| Merced County Office of Educa Merced, CA | FFN Pilot Project | $8,000 |
